08/08/2005, 10:49
|
| | | Fecha de Ingreso: mayo-2005 Ubicación: Bogota, Colombia
Mensajes: 106
Antigüedad: 19 años, 6 meses Puntos: 2 | |
mira:
int funcion(int x)
{
if (x==8) {cout<<"mi valor es"<<x;return 1;}
x=8;
cout<<"mi valor es"<<x;
getch();
return 0;
}
observa que el return se utiliza para cortar una función cuando llega a un resultado satisfactorio.....
o continuar hasta que lo haga
observa:
void funcion(int x)
{
if (x==8) {cout<<"mi valor es"<<x;return;}
x=8;
cout<<"mi valor es"<<x;
getch();
return;
}
como la funcion es void no retorna nada y tambien podemos cortarla cuando queramos... esto sirve bastante y nos ahorra en cierta forma la mamera de los if largos hasta el final como por ejemplo:
void funcion(int x)
{
if (x==8) {cout<<"mi valor es"<<x;}
else
{
x=8;
cout<<"mi valor es"<<x;
}
getch();
}
__________________ :cool: Nadie enseña a nadie...
todos aprendemos de todos....!!! |